> I've had my Zire 72 for a few years now and it's worked just fine till
> recently.  I've noticed that it no longer detects when I insert or
> remove an SD card.   Even the SD card I normally leave in it remains
> undetected upon insertion or removal.  If I reset the unit then it
> reads the new card fine, but not before a reset.  Any ideas why and how
> to fix it?
> 
> Thanks
> 
> -V

Are you running any hacks on your Palm? Have you installed any software which
intervenes with the core? Judging by 'reset as a solution', there's no
symptom to suggest a hardware fault or interference such as the accumulation
of dust in the slot.
